Alex is a calendar year sole proprietor. He began business on December 1, this year. He uses the accrual method of accounting. Alex had the following collections in December:

•  Collected $7,000 in December, from clients who paid cash for services to be performed next year.
•  Collected $5,000 in December, for services performed during December; deposited in an operating account on December 31, this year.
•  Collected $12,000 in December; on accounts receivable for services performed in December; deposited in operating account on January 2, next year.

What is the amount Alex must include in his income for December?
◦ $7,000
◦ $12,000
◦ $17,000
◦ $24,000

Every flu season is different, and even healthy people can get extremely sick from the flu, as well as spread it to others. The flu season can begin as early as October and last as late as May. Every person over six months of age should get an annual flu vaccine. The vaccine cannot cause you to get influenza, but in some seasons, may not be completely able to prevent you from acquiring influenza due to changes in causative viruses. The viruses in the flu shot are killed—there is no way they can give you the flu. Minor side effects include soreness, redness, or swelling where the shot was given. It is possible to develop a slight fever, and body aches, but these are simply signs that the body is responding to the vaccine and making itself ready to fight off the influenza virus should you come in contact with it.

Prostaglandins were first isolated from human semen in Sweden in the 1930s. They were so named because the researcher thought that they came from the prostate gland. In fact, prostaglandins exist and are synthesized in almost every cell of the body.
